Directors Carles Torras and Ramon Térmens utilized a raw, handheld camera aesthetic to emphasize the chaotic nature of the characters' decisions. The film heavily tackles several core themes:

The film also presents two other stories of disillusioned youth, focusing on themes of toxic masculinity and xenophobia. One involves the character Pau, whose angry, violent, and xenophobic attitudes emerge as he struggles with his ex-girlfriend dating a Moroccan immigrant. The third story follows Jordi, a stockbroker whose risky, morally questionable investments fail spectacularly. By including Cristina's story alongside these two narratives of male aggression, the film creates an ensemble portrait of a young generation grappling with various forms of desperation and dangerous behavior.
